Excerpt from Oh, What a Plague Is Love

Charles Frederick Marmaduke Strangways, commonly called 'Duke' by his friends, had been for years a cause of anxiety to his steady-going, irreproachable family. There had been many times when one or other of his sons or daughters, in a fit of discouragement, had declared wearily that they despaired of his ever settling down, and indeed Duke was incurably erratic. Men who had been his contemporaries pottered about their gardens in summer, and were content with the easy-chair by the chimney-nook in winter. They were grandfathers long since, but Duke's children gave no sign of making him a grandfather.
